How they compare
Panama currently reports 94.7% against 94.1% in Dominican Republic, a difference of 0.6%.
The two have swapped places 10 times across 21 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Panama ahead.
Dominican Republic ranks 17th and Panama ranks 15th of 37 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Dominican Republic averaged higher in 1 and Panama in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Dominican Republic | Panama |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 75.3% | 82.4% | 7.1% | Panama |
| 2010s | 90.6% | 91.7% | 1.1% | Panama |
| 2020s | 94.4% | 94.2% | 0.1% | Dominican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
